two.1.4) Short description
Nottinghamshire County Council require a Provider/Providers of Care, Support and Enablement services to deliver two Supported Living schemes in the district of Bassetlaw, Nottinghamshire.
The Providers will be required to facilitate the provision of the accommodation via their relationship with a Housing Provider/Providers and deliver the Care, Support and Enablement services required to meet the needs of the people residing within the accommodation.
The services are configured in two Lots. Bids may be submitted for either one, or both of the Lots.

two.2.4) Description of the procurement
It is a requirement of this tender that bidders can demonstrate a minimum of three years’ experience of delivering Care, Support and Enablement (CSE) services for adults (mainly aged 18-64) with disabilities within Supported Living accommodation-based services which incorporate communal facilities and are staffed on a 24-hour basis.
Whilst most of the CSE services required under the Contracts will fall outside of the scope of the Care Quality Commission’s (CQC) definition of Regulated Activity, it is a requirement of this tender that bidders have an active registration with the CQC for delivering personal care services. The successful bidder/s will need to ensure that any personal care delivered in relation to these services is covered by their CQC registration/s before the Contracts commence.
Lot 1: 8 units of self-contained accommodation providing 8 tenancies in the Bassetlaw district of Nottinghamshire. The accommodation must also include a staff room with shower facility and communal space.
The accommodation must be available for occupation no later than 3 months after the award date.
The Contract will have a maximum term of 25 years. This will be configured as an initial term of 5 years and will then continue on an annual rolling renewal basis for up to a further 20 years.
The estimated annual Contract value of Lot 1 is £720,928. The total Contract value over the maximum potential term of 25 years for Lot 1 is £18,023,200.
